Understanding Multicultural Gaming Platforms
Multicultural gaming platforms are online casinos that go beyond a single linguistic or cultural focus. They are built with an international audience in mind, offering a comprehensive and inclusive experience for players from different regions. This approach encompasses various elements, from the visual design of the website to the underlying operational infrastructure.
Key Characteristics of Multicultural Platforms
These platforms distinguish themselves through several core features that directly benefit a diverse player base.
Multilingual Support
One of the most immediate indicators of a multicultural platform is its support for multiple languages. This extends beyond just the website interface to customer support, game instructions, and even promotional materials. For beginners, having access to information in their native language significantly reduces barriers to understanding and participation, fostering a sense of comfort and trust.
Diverse Currency and Payment Options
A truly multicultural platform understands that players from different countries utilize various currencies and payment methods. This includes supporting major international currencies like EUR and USD, but also often extends to local currencies and popular regional payment gateways, e-wallets, and banking solutions. This flexibility ensures that players can deposit and withdraw funds conveniently and securely, without incurring excessive conversion fees or facing compatibility issues.
Localized Content and Game Selection
While many casino games are universally popular, multicultural platforms often curate their game libraries to include titles that resonate with specific cultural preferences. This might involve offering games with themes popular in certain regions, or even incorporating specific variations of classic games that are favored by particular demographics. Furthermore, promotional offers and bonuses might be tailored to align with local holidays or events, creating a more personalized and engaging experience.
Regulatory Compliance and Licensing
Operating across multiple jurisdictions requires adherence to various regulatory frameworks. Reputable multicultural platforms hold licenses from multiple respected authorities, demonstrating their commitment to fair play, responsible gambling, and player protection in different regions. For beginners, checking for these licenses is a vital step in ensuring the legitimacy and trustworthiness of a platform.
Customer Support Accessibility
Effective customer support is paramount, especially for new players. Multicultural platforms often provide 24/7 support through various channels (live chat, email, phone) and in multiple languages. This ensures that players can receive assistance whenever they need it, regardless of their time zone or preferred language.

Verify Licensing and Regulation
Before depositing any funds, always check for valid licenses from reputable regulatory bodies. This information is usually found in the footer of the website. For players in the Czech Republic, looking for licenses from European authorities is a good starting point.
Read Terms and Conditions Carefully
Pay close attention to the terms and conditions, especially regarding bonuses, wagering requirements, and withdrawal policies. These can vary significantly between platforms and regions. If available, read them in your preferred language.
Explore Payment Methods
Ensure that the platform supports convenient and secure payment methods that are available in your country. Familiarize yourself with any associated fees or processing times for deposits and withdrawals.
Test Customer Support
Before committing to a platform, consider testing its customer support. Send a query in your preferred language to gauge their responsiveness and helpfulness. This can be a good indicator of their commitment to player satisfaction.
Start with Free Play Options
Many online casinos offer demo versions of their games. Utilize these free play options to familiarize yourself with game mechanics, rules, and strategies without risking real money. This is an excellent way for beginners to gain confidence.
Set a Budget and Stick to It
Responsible gambling is paramount. Before you start playing, set a strict budget for yourself and never exceed it. Online gambling should be viewed as entertainment, not a guaranteed source of income.
